Rotary Wing Powertrain

Course CodeATAC-402
Lecture hours per week
Lab hours per week
Course AvailabilityOpen
Description

This course will introduce the basic concepts of rotary wing flight and the more advanced aspects and elaboration of rotary wing principles.

Students will learn of the various types and sizes of engines employed by rotary wing aircraft, as well as the different types of drivetrain mechanisms and the different requirements for servicing and repair of these components.

The student will learn the requirement for and the standard practices associated with the rigging of flight controls on rotary wing flight controls.
